1. COMPANY PROFILE

India International Insurance Pte Ltd is an established general insurer in Singapore serving since 1987, with significant expertise in underwriting of Property, Engineering, Marine (Hull and Cargo), Motor and other Liability classes of general insurance.

We’re rated by Standard & Poor’s as “A-“

Our Core strengths are strong capital position with robust solvency ratio, management team of well qualified and highly experienced professionals, strong niche player in the competitive Singapore insurance market, and capacity to underwrite a wide spectrum of risks.

All efforts are made to achieve the objective of Excellent Customer Service.

4. Enterprise Risk Management (ERM) Framework

The Board oversees the adequacy and effectiveness of the Company’s ERM and internal controls. 

In carrying out its duty, the Board has established an Enterprise Risk Management Committee (ERMC) chaired by the Chief Executive & Managing Director.

The ERMC comprises of the Chief Executive & Managing Director, the Chief Financial Officer and the Chief Risk Officer. It assists the III’s Board of Directors to formulate the risk policy and operates adhering to the risk appetite statements for the risks below:

a. Credit 
b. Insurance
c. Market
d. Liquidity
e. Strategic
f. Operational 

In terms of governance over the ERM activities, III has undertaken the following:

  • Risk governance framework designed to prevent, mitigate and manage risk through a line of defence model providing for an effective balance of business control and oversight and assurance testing.
  • Governance principles embedded in the values, behaviours and code of conduct throughout the Company.
  • Strong oversight by the Board on all key decisions and challenges.
  • Board and Executive Management interact effectively to deliver an agreed overall business strategy.
  • Organizational structure that encourages clear accountability and ownership aligned with legal entity structure.
  • Board oversees execution of strategy consistent with local regulatory and governance requirements.
  • Develop and communicate the importance of a risk aware culture across the Company.
  • Align the risk management activities to the strategic objectives of III in order to manage risks to support the delivery of the business plan.

All the above has been documented in III ERM Policy and III ERM Framework.
